# Install Guide
## 1. node
### 1. get node
wget -c http://nodejs.org/dist/v0.10.15/node-v0.10.15-linux-x64.tar.gz
### 2. uncompress
tar -zxvf node-v0.10.15-linux-x64.tar.gz -C /usr/local/
### 3. export to env
export PATH=$PATH:/usr/local/node/bin/
## 3. phantomjs
### 1. get phantomjs
wget -c https://phantomjs.googlecode.com/files/phantomjs-1.9.1-linux-x86_64.tar.bz2
### 2. install
bunzip2 phantomjs-1.9.1-linux-x86_64.tar.bz2 && tar xvf phantomjs-1.9.1-linux-x86_64.tar -C /usr/local/
### 3. export PHANTOMJS_BIN
export PHANTOMJS_BIN=/usr/local/phantomjs/bin/phantomjs
## 2. karma
### Global installation
npm install -g karma
### Local installation
npm install karma
# How to run
## 1. Generate config with karma
cd project-with-js-test/config && karma init
### 2. Step by Step choose
### 3. Manually config karma.conf.js
* I put a sample config in the folder, you can copy it as karma.conf.js
### 4. Run test
there are some sample test code in the unit folder, run it directly.
after test finished, the test result would be found in the result folder.

## JSON example
### 1. add fixtures files in karma.conf.js
{
pattern: '../fixtures/json/*.json',
watched: true,
included: false,
served: true
}
### 2. add proxy config into karma.conf.js
proxies = {
'/': 'http://localhost:3000/'
}
### 3. need to start a file proxy server, here i use python SimpleHTTPServer
python -m SimpleHTTPServer 3000
### 4. start test
karma start config/karma.conf.js

# Code Coverage
## Install Istanbul
npm install -g istanbul
## Config karma with coverage feature
preprocessors = {
'**/js/*.js': 'coverage'
};
reporters = [..., 'converage']
coverageReporter = {
type : 'html',
dir : '../coverage/',
file : 'coverage.html'
}
